Q: Is 788,070 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 788,070 is a composite number.

Why is 788,070 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 788,070 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 5 6 10 15 30 109 218 241 327 482 545 654 723 1,090 1,205 1,446 1,635 2,410 3,270 3,615 7,230 26,269 52,538 78,807 131,345 157,614 262,690 394,035 and 788,070, with no remainder.

Since 788,070 cannot be divided by just 1 and 788,070, it is a composite number.
